The United States Women’s National Team has faced a lot of criticism throughout the 2023 FIFA Women’s World Cup from their silence during the national anthem to their play on the field. But according to a couple of former UWSWNT stars, it’s unlikely that criticism is actually affecting the team.

During a recent interview with SB Nation, USWNT stars Tobin Heath and Christen Press made it clear that the team has laser focus on the task at hand while they’re competing in the World Cup.

“They’re in win mode,” Press told SB Nation. “And there’s no team better in the world to handle this kind of noise than our team.”

“Nobody cares,” Heath said. “it’s so funny because we’re all here giving our opinions and think we matter. Honestly, it’s the biggest [lie] that anybody notices because all these players are fully focused on getting the job done.”

“That’s true for praise as much as it is criticism,” notes Press. “For myself as a player I find that the positive press just as toxic, if not more toxic than the negative press — because you kinda become a little addicted to it. It’s external validation. […] You have to ignore the praise as much as you ignore the criticism.”

So people can say what they want, it won’t bother the team one bit.
